What Your Catalytic Converter Does
Think of your catalytic converter as the clean-air bouncer for your car’s exhaust system. Its job is to take all the nasty stuff your engine produces, like carbon monoxide, hydrocarbons, and nitrogen oxides, and transform them into less harmful gases before they head out the tailpipe.
Without it, your car would run dirtier, smell worse, and almost certainly fail Utah’s emissions test. It also plays a role in keeping your engine running efficiently, so when it’s not working right, you’ll feel it in your wallet and on the road.

Signs Your Catalytic Converter Might Be Failing
Here’s what usually tips drivers off that something’s wrong and how it might sound if you were wondering about it yourself.
1. Check Engine Light with P0420 Code
You’re cruising along when the check engine light pops on. You plug in your little code reader and up comes “P0420 – Catalyst System Efficiency Below Threshold.” Now you’re Googling what that even means and learning it might be the catalytic converter.
2. Rotten Egg Smell
You step out of your car and get hit with a sulfur smell that could clear a room. You’re thinking, “That can’t be normal… and I didn’t even have eggs for breakfast. Why does my car smell like rotten eggs?”
3. Sluggish Acceleration or Poor Fuel Economy
You press the gas, but your car acts like it’s pulling a trailer full of bricks. At the pump, you notice you’re filling up more often than usual because with gas prices these days, you can’t help but wonder why, and start thinking something’s clogged.
4. Rattling Noise Under the Car
You start the engine and hear a rattle from underneath like someone shaking a can of gravel. You figure it’s an exhaust issue, but it keeps happening, and now you’re suspicious.
5. Failed Emissions Test
You go in for your annual emissions test, and boom, you fail. The tech hints it might be the catalytic converter, and you’re now searching for a fix before your registration deadline.
Repair vs. Replacement: Which One Do You Need?
Not all catalytic converter issues require a full replacement. Here’s how we generally break it down:
You might get away with a repair if:
The problem is actually with an oxygen sensor or exhaust leak near the converter.
There’s only minor clogging that can be cleared.
Heat shields or external components need fixing, not the core unit.
Replacement is likely if:
The ceramic honeycomb inside has melted or broken apart.
Severe clogging is choking your engine’s performance.
There’s internal contamination from oil or coolant leaks.
General cost context: Repairs can be relatively inexpensive if it’s just a sensor or exhaust patch. Full replacements cost more, especially for newer cars with complex emission systems, but acting fast can prevent even pricier engine damage.

Why You Shouldn’t Wait to Fix It
A failing catalytic converter isn’t just bad for the environment; it’s bad for your car. Driving with one too long can:
Damage your engine from excessive backpressure.
Lead to failed emissions and prevent registration renewal in Utah.
Result in costly repairs that could’ve been avoided.
Plus, if you’re thinking, “I’ll just ignore it until next inspection,” keep in mind: the longer you drive with it failing, the more likely you are to cause secondary damage.
